Common questions

How many calories are in Crêpes Sucrées?

Crêpes Sucrées by Carrefour has 330 kcal per 100 g.

How much protein is in Crêpes Sucrées?

Crêpes Sucrées contains 4.8 g of protein per 100 g.

Is Crêpes Sucrées low in sodium?

Yes — just 60 mg per 100 g (3% of the daily value), which qualifies as low sodium.

Why does Crêpes Sucrées have a Nutri-Score of C?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from sugar (13 g). Overall that places it in band C.

How much Crêpes Sucrées is 100 calories?

About 30 g of Crêpes Sucrées equals 100 kcal. It is energy-dense, so small amounts add up quickly.

Is Crêpes Sucrées high in sugar or fat?

Per 100 g it has 13 g sugar and 14 g fat (2.3 g saturated). Fat provides 39% of its calories, so portion size matters most here.
